Why Hialeah Gardens Homes Are Different

Hialeah Gardens sits close enough to the Everglades that the humidity does not ease up much, even in winter. Coastal cities get sea breezes that dry things out between storms. Hialeah Gardens gets standing moisture, and it works on gate hardware all year. Unpainted steel oxidizes fast, motor housings sweat internally, and hinges that would last fifteen years somewhere drier often give out in eight or nine. We see it weekly on the warehouse gates along Okeechobee Road and NW 87th Avenue.

The residential picture is its own thing. Most homes in Hialeah Gardens are 1980s to 2000s concrete block and stucco builds, and the driveway gates were typically added after original construction by a security-conscious homeowner, not the original builder. Those gates often sit on undersized posts with footings that were never poured deep enough for the span. When a gate starts to sag, it’s rarely the panel that failed first. It’s the post. And the industrial picture is older still: many of the slide gate operators along the warehouse corridors went in before Miami-Dade’s post-Hurricane Andrew wind-load code tightening, which means a simple motor failure can turn into a mandatory NOA-compliant replacement. That catches property owners off guard mid-repair, and it’s something we flag before you buy parts.

Electric Gate Repair

Most electric gate failures in Hialeah Gardens start where the power meets the operator. Capacitors burn out, circuit boards get zapped by afternoon lightning storms, and limit switches drift after years of hard cycles. We troubleshoot on the spot, and we stock common boards, capacitors, and limit switch parts for LiftMaster, Viking, FAAC, and BFT operators. A typical electric gate repair in Hialeah Gardens runs $180 to $340, which covers most limit switches, photo eyes, and capacitor replacements on common commercial operators.

Automatic Gate Repair

An automatic gate that opens but won’t close, or closes but won’t reopen, is a safety problem on a warehouse loading lane. The usual culprits are failed photo eyes, cracked loop detector wires, or a control board that’s lost its programming. On Okeechobee Road near West 92nd Avenue, we repaired a Viking rack-and-pinion slide gate that had jumped its track and chewed four teeth off the rack after a forklift clipped it. We cut away the damaged section, welded in a new three-foot rack segment, re-tensioned the chain, and had the gate cycling again the same day. Automatic gate diagnostics are included in the repair cost; we don’t charge $150 just to show up and tell you what’s broken.

Gate Realignment

Along Hialeah Gardens’s warehouse corridors, the dominant failure isn’t a broken hinge. It’s a sliding gate that has come out of square after years of hurricane-force gusts or the occasional clip from a delivery truck. A gate that’s even slightly out of alignment binds the operator, burns out motors, and eventually strips the rack teeth. We reset the track, shim the rollers, re-align the rack and pinion mesh, and test the full cycle under load. A rack section replacement with on-site welding typically lands between $250 and $450, depending on how many teeth stripped and whether the post footing needs rebuilding. That’s a repair we do on site in most cases, not a tear-out.

Why does my Hialeah Gardens slide gate keep stopping halfway and reversing?

A slide gate that stops mid-travel and reverses is almost always tripping a safety input or a motor load fault. In Hialeah Gardens, the three most common causes are a cracked loop detector wire under the asphalt, a photo eye knocked out of alignment by a truck mirror, or a rack-and-pinion mesh bound up after a forklift clip. Do Hialeah Gardens commercial gates need Miami-Dade NOA-compliant parts during a repair?

Repairs to the existing operator, rack, hinges, or loop system generally do not trigger a full NOA review, since you’re fixing what’s already approved and installed. The trigger point is replacement: a new gate panel, a new operator, or any structural change to the gate must meet Miami-Dade product-approval requirements. Linear Motor

Linear motors are becoming the preferred replacement on older Hialeah Gardens slide gates because there’s no rack and pinion to wear out. On existing industrial gates with worn gear racks, a linear motor conversion often costs less over five years than rebuilding the rack and replacing a conventional motor. We service Linear brand units and install them on both new and existing gates. Expect $2,800 to $5,000 for a linear conversion on a typical 20-foot industrial slide gate, including the entrapment sensors Miami-Dade requires.

My warehouse slide gate operator lasted 20 years. Why does a repair now require a Miami-Dade NOA when the old one didn’t?

Because the old operator was installed before Miami-Dade’s post-Hurricane Andrew wind-load code took effect, and it was grandfathered in. The moment you replace a major component like the motor or operator on a commercial gate in Hialeah Gardens, the new equipment must meet current NOA standards. That often means a more expensive operator and safety package than the original, plus possible lead time for NOA-approved equipment. We flag this before you spend a dollar. My slide gate trips the breaker every afternoon when it rains. Is this a Hialeah Gardens humidity issue?

Yes, almost certainly. Hialeah Gardens sits close to the Everglades, and summer storms soak everything. If your gate motor’s enclosure seals are compromised, moisture gets into the wiring and the breaker trips when the motor draws current through a wet connection. Why does my keypad entry work in the morning but fail after an afternoon thunderstorm in Hialeah Gardens?

That pattern almost always points to water intrusion or a surge-sensitive board. Hialeah Gardens thunderstorms come hard and fast, and an exterior keypad or its wiring can take on enough moisture to intermittently short the circuit. Once it dries out the next morning, it works again until the next storm. The fix is a properly sealed enclosure, sealed conduit fittings, and sometimes surge protection at the operator. Rail Repair

Slide gates in Hialeah Gardens jump the rail for two reasons: worn rollers and rusted rail tracks. High-humidity, low-airflow zones accelerate rust on the track, and that’s before you factor in the daily abuse of a 40-foot steel gate cycling dozens of times per shift. Rail repair and roller replacement on a commercial slide gate runs $400 to $900 depending on the length of rail and how many rollers are shot. We repair or replace rail sections, align the gate, and test the full cycle before we leave.

My gate sags but the panel looks straight. Is a weld repair enough?

No. A gate sags in the hinge post, not the middle of the panel. If your Hialeah Gardens gate is sagging but the panel still looks true, the post has likely leaned, usually because the original footing was poured too shallow when the gate was added after the house was built. Do I need to update my old gate operator to meet Miami-Dade’s current wind-load rules for a simple roller replacement?

No. Replacing rollers on a slide gate in Hialeah Gardens doesn’t trigger the NOA requirement. The wind-load and product-approval rules apply when the operator itself is replaced, or when the gate panel is substantially modified. Roller replacement is a service repair.
